I just wired a new spa and the gfci keeps tripping. I know I wired it correctly, It is 6-3 wire with ground The 50 amp gfci subpanel is hot. Every time I try to power up the gfci trips. Any ideas?
Kill the power, and take your volt meter and check the continuity between the power legs and ground. Then go to the heater and check for resistance from each of the power legs to ground. You should find your problem. Most of my spa problems have been the heaters they may still work, but they leak voltage to ground and are not safe anymore.
Possibly not wired right. Probable issues are with line and load neutrals not being kept separate EVERYWHERE. Needs some pics on how the spa panel is wired an how the feed is wired. Use go advanced/manage attachments to post.
